Drain Trenching in Houston, TX

Drain trenching services involve the excavation of narrow, deep channels in the ground to install or repair drainage systems on residential properties. This process is commonly used for projects such as installing new drain lines, improving yard drainage, managing stormwater runoff, or replacing aging or damaged underground pipes. Property owners often seek this service to prevent water accumulation around foundations, reduce flooding risks, or ensure proper drainage for landscaping and outdoor structures.

Before requesting drain trenching, homeowners should consider the location and purpose of the drainage system, as well as the underground utilities and existing landscape features. Understanding the scope of the project, including the length and depth of trenches needed, helps in planning and ensures the work aligns with property needs. It’s also helpful to be aware of any local regulations or permits that may be required for underground work. Proper planning can contribute to an effective drainage solution that maintains the safety and integrity of the property.

Project Types

Common Drain Trenching Jobs

Drain trenching - creates a dedicated channel to direct surface and groundwater away from foundations.

Foundation drainage - helps prevent water accumulation around basements and crawl spaces.

Landscape drainage - improves yard grading to reduce standing water and erosion issues.

Sump pump drainage - installs trenches to efficiently channel water to sump systems or drainage points.

Stormwater management - designs trench systems to handle heavy rain runoff and protect property.

Erosion control - stabilizes slopes and prevents soil washout through proper trenching solutions.

FAQ

Drain Trenching Questions

What is drain trenching? Drain trenching involves digging narrow, deep channels to redirect or manage underground water flow around a property.

When is drain trenching necessary? It is typically needed to prevent basement flooding, improve drainage around foundations, or install new drainage systems.

What types of projects require drain trenching? Projects include installing French drains, improving yard drainage, or redirecting stormwater away from structures.

What should property owners consider before trenching? It's important to assess underground utilities, soil conditions, and drainage needs to ensure proper installation and effectiveness.
